Transcript

Good morning!

Thank you so much for joining me here in this mindful meditation,

Starting your day off on the right note.

As we get started,

Nestled in to a nice comfortable position.

Whether you're sitting up straight or laying down,

Just start to tune into your breath.

Nice big inhale through the nose,

Fill the belly with air,

Feel the chest rise,

And really taking in this gratitude for seeing another day.

The ability to make this day however you want it to be.

You are strong,

You are capable,

You are grateful.

Breathe it in and let it all go.

If you're feeling a little bit exhausted today,

That's okay.

Give yourself some grace,

Some kindness.

I want you to start to call back all of your energy.

Perhaps you've left pieces of your energy in different places,

With different people,

With different things.

I just want you to imagine all of these little pieces of your energy fitting together like a puzzle.

I want you to imagine that you're a magnet,

Calling back all of your energy all throughout the world,

And bring it back to yourself.

Take a breath in,

Exhale,

Release.

And with all of this newfound energy,

I want you to imagine this inner fire coming from about three fingers below your belly button.

And I want you to breathe into this area here,

Really igniting this inner fire,

Getting your energy back.

Start your day off.

Now I want you to imagine how you want to show up today.

Who do you want to be today?

What do you want to do today?

And how do you want to do these things?

Imagine yourself going through your day as the best version of yourself.

Breathe that in,

Feel it in your body,

Tune into the sensations,

And let it go.

And then allowing opportunities to flow to you,

And remembering to be very present.

Coming back to this present moment on this morning,

Not thinking about what we had last night for dinner,

What we're going to do later.

Come back to right here,

Right now.

Tuning into your breath,

Into your inhales,

The feeling of the air coming into your nostrils,

The feeling of your belly rising,

The feeling of your chest expanding,

The feeling of your muscles grazing whichever chair or bed you're sitting or laying on.

Come back to this safe space we've created here.

Breathe it in,

Finding gratitude for this morning,

For this day.

You get to show up as the best version of yourself today,

Whatever that means to you.

Thanking yourself for showing up today,

Finding love in your heart for yourself,

For committing to your meditation practice.

I'm very grateful you joined me this morning,

And I hope you have a wonderful rest of your day.

I'll see you in more meditation soon.

Much love.
